The Lifelong Learning Support Project (LLSP) was part of the JISC-funded MLEs for Lifelong Learning Programme, offering all of these projects a menu of support activities and resources. It was managed by the Centre for Recording Achievement and supported by CETIS.

Resources for scenario building

  • Why? Scenarios describe typical uses of a system as narratives or stories. Scenarios will help practitioners, learners, systems developers and managers to have a shared understanding of the purpose of a system and how the system can benefit all stakeholders.
  • What? This contains examples of built scenarios from the MLEs for Lifelong Learning projects.
  • How? Here are some examples of documents to support the construction of scenarios including those from workshops, courses and a resource pack.

The UK Developmental LIP CETIS sub-site (archive only)
Here were the resources relevant to the developing UK profile of the IMS LIP specification, working towards British Standard 8788, UKLeaP: the UK Learner Profile. This work is now taken forward as LEAP 2.0
